Careers That Horticulture Grads May Go Into
A degree in horticulture can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for KY, the home state for Western Kentucky University.
Occupation | Jobs in KY | Average Salary in KY |
---|---|---|
Retail Sales Supervisors | 17,020 | $38,060 |
Landscaping, Lawn Service, and Groundskeeping Supervisors | 1,250 | $45,210 |
Pesticide Applicators | 200 | $31,790 |
Agricultural Sciences Professors | 110 | $71,930 |
Farmers, Ranchers, and Agricultural Managers | 60 | $78,290 |
